Output d8958158fd56eabc23245bfe8e89e00f2657db227a751d916f98fbe093af2c82:25

value
1654257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58b03861dfe0d27f19a4d465f074f507062d395 OP_EQUAL
address
3KhXaBQ4KaqxGCqwfDR2GQkGvJiMdwReuQ
transaction
d8958158fd56eabc23245bfe8e89e00f2657db227a751d916f98fbe093af2c82
spent
true